PIC16F631/677/685/687/689/690 8 位闪存微控制器Microchip 的 PIC16F 系列微控制器 8 位 MCU,将 Microchip 的 PIC® 体系架构融入到引脚和封装选件中,从节省空间的 14 引脚设备到功能丰富的 64 引脚设备。 带有基线、中级或增强型中级体系架构的设备提供多种不同的外围设备组合,可谓设计人员提供灵活性,并为应用提供选择。 PIC16F631/677/685/687/689/690 系列微控制器基于 Microchip 的中级内核,带 8 层深硬件堆栈和 35 个指令。 这些 MCU 提供高达 5 个 MIP、7 千字节程序存储器、256 字节 RAM 和 256 字节数据 EEPROM。 板载是一个可配置振荡器,工厂校准到 ±1% 精确度。### 微控制器功能最大 20 MHz CPU 速度 35 指令 8 级硬件堆栈 8 MHz 内部振荡器 - 可选频率范围 8 MHz 至 32 kHz 18 个输入/输出引脚 通电重置 (POR) 通电计时器 (PWRT) 振荡器启动计时器 (OST) 掉电重置 (BOR) 监控器计时器 (WDT) 在线串行编程 (ICSP) ### 外设12 通道 10 位模拟到数字转换器 – 仅限 PIC16F677/685/687/689/690 型号 两个比较器 8 位计时器 - PIC16F631/677/687/689 型号 x 1、PIC16F685/690 型号 x 2 一个 16 位计时器 增强型捕获、比较、PWM 模块 - 仅限 PIC16F685/690 型号 同步串行端口 (SSP) - 仅限 PIC16F677/687/689/690 型号 增强型通用异步接收器发送器 (EUSART) - 仅限 PIC16F687/689/690 型号 ### PIC16 微控制器展开
